OK. I ended up just doing a fresh install and configured all of the controllers while the XB360 controller was plugged in. That fixed whatever issue I was having with that. For future reference, where would I find this log you speak of?

If you launch from a command line with --verbose, it will print the log to the console. You can also add --log-file=filename.txt and it will print that to a file instead.

You don’t really need to configure Xbox360 controllers, the configurations are baked in.
